[Bug]: Front end progress not progressing after browser reload

When you queue buncha jobs and reload the browser page with ComfyUI while the queue is still running then the progress information for all the jobs from before the reload is no longer showing / updating in the front end.
Talking about the total percentages here only (workflow and node progress %).

Not a big issue. Right now it shows only in Browser Tab title from what I know.

### Expected Behavior

Report and show valid generation progress after browser was realoaded.

### Actual Behavior

When you reaload the browser page the progress information for the current job is not showing at all in the browser tab and for all the following jobs from before the reload it shows progress at 100% all the time.

### Steps to Reproduce

Queue several workflow jobs and while the queue is still running reload the browser page.
Observe incorrect progress reported in the browser tab title.

### Other Information

From what I managed to dig out, the **executionStore** holds its own copy of the queue to provide its services.
The items are added to this internal queue by `app.queuePrompt` after prompt was submitted to server.
However, this front-end stored queue is lost when you reload page and neither **app** nor **executionStore** attempt to rebuild it after page is loaded.

Similarly the same applies if one is running comfyui from multiple browser tabs. Only the tab from which the prompt was queued will report progress information about that job.

This is minor issue but reporting it here in case it might shed light while investigating any other progress reporting problems in the future.
